| Aspect | Economics Internship | Data Analyst Internship |
|---|
| Required Credentials | Typically pursuing or holding a degree in Economics, Finance, or related fields | Usually requires a degree in Statistics, Mathematics, Computer Science, or related fields |
| Work Environment | Research settings, financial institutions, government agencies | Corporate offices, tech companies, consulting firms |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Economics departments, financial firms, policy organizations | Business, finance, technology sectors |
| Common Search & Comparison Intent | Understanding internship opportunities in economics | Exploring data analysis internship roles |
While both internships involve data handling and analytical skills, Economics Internships focus on economic theories, policy analysis, and financial research, whereas Data Analyst Internships emphasize data manipulation, visualization, and technical skills. Candidates should choose based on their career interests and educational background.
